Output 95244752b62ec37a41a63385906411990ad5923867990bb54d716e5fe9c796a8:76

value
9384861
script pubkey
OP_0 OP_PUSHBYTES_20 18c1a5af1abc16b8936cfbb9ab13723b92eee30a
address
bc1qrrq6ttc6hstt3ymvlwu6kymj8wfwacc29r38h4
transaction
95244752b62ec37a41a63385906411990ad5923867990bb54d716e5fe9c796a8